My transport is recording and playing back twice as fast in Lexington. The counter in the control bar is counting seconds at a 2:1 ratio. Is there something I should check?
I should add that I changed nothing by way of settings in Kingston prior to upgrading, and X3e is still working fine.
Update: It seems the Lexington update reverted my sampling rate to 44.1khz. In previous versions, such as X3, if I tried playback or recording in mismatched sampling rates, I'd get an error saying the DAW couldn't open the record device. I no longer see that error in this latest version, and the recording will commence at the wrong sampling rate (like faster ips), skewing the time-stamp in the Control bar. I believe people should be aware of this potential frustration of tracking at the wrong "speed". Had I not seen this, I would have been upset.
Feature Request: If the sampling rate or bit rate is mismatched from the expected or source clock/bit rate, turn the Control Bar time display orange.
